    Have found a few reference on the net to this pattern.  Replacements has it listed but none are available.  Ruby Lane has a 12" Platter going for $24.00.  So we have a pattern that has little availability, Nice Pattern almost call it semi-fancy.  This in it self will limit the collector base on these items.  Meakin has good name this will help.  With the hallmark we know it is post 1890, doesn't help too much.  I would say you are looking at a Post 20's, Pre 40's pattern, again this is a guess.  Platter at $24.00, Platters being usually mid collectible level, (dinner plate low, Tea cup High).  Dinner plate $5 to Teacup $30.00.  Would gamble it to be a slow market mover, but would move.  Keep in mind this would be items in excellent condition, damage, chips and etc.  about 25% of value.  the only other comment I would add is the guy who sold them to you said 1890, that is when this stamp was beginning to be used and could and most likely much later.
